in entertainment law, what is the most important step for me to do before i record a song with a producer?
Media and Entertainment
Intellectual Property
Copyright
Hi. The important step to take before recording a song with a producer is to have a contract signed between yourself and the producer. In fact, this ought to be done before or at the same time payment is made. Such contract will address issues of ownership rights as well as other important factors. Hope this helps.

About Intellectual Property Law in Nigeria

Intellectual property law in Nigeria protects the creations of the mind, such as inventions, literary and artistic works, designs, symbols, names, and images used in commerce. This area of law aims to incentivize innovation by granting creators exclusive rights to their intellectual property for a set period.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

You may need a lawyer for intellectual property matters in Nigeria if you are looking to obtain patents, trademarks, or copyrights, need to enforce your intellectual property rights, or are facing allegations of infringing someone else's intellectual property.

Local Laws Overview

In Nigeria, intellectual property is governed by several laws, including the Copyright Act, Patents and Designs Act, and Trademarks Act. These laws provide the framework for protecting various forms of intellectual property and outline the registration and enforcement procedures.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the difference between a copyright, patent, and trademark?

A copyright protects original literary, artistic, and musical works, while a patent protects inventions and designs, and a trademark protects logos, symbols, and names used in commerce.

2. How do I register a trademark in Nigeria?

You can register a trademark in Nigeria by submitting an application to the Nigerian Trademarks, Patents, and Designs Registry along with the required fees and supporting documentation.

3. How long does a trademark registration last in Nigeria?

A trademark registration in Nigeria is valid for an initial period of seven years and can be renewed indefinitely for subsequent ten-year periods.

4. What is the process for obtaining a patent in Nigeria?

To obtain a patent in Nigeria, you must file a patent application with the Nigerian Patents and Designs Registry, which will conduct an examination to determine the patentability of your invention.

5. Can I copyright my creative work without registering it?

Yes, copyright protection in Nigeria automatically applies to original works upon their creation, but registering your work provides additional evidence of ownership and can be useful in legal disputes.

6. What are the penalties for intellectual property infringement in Nigeria?

Penalties for intellectual property infringement in Nigeria can include fines, damages, injunctions, and even imprisonment in cases of severe infringement.

7. How can I prove that my intellectual property has been infringed in Nigeria?

You can prove intellectual property infringement in Nigeria through evidence such as dated records of creation, copies of registration certificates, and documentation of the unauthorized use of your intellectual property by others.

8. Can I license my intellectual property rights to others in Nigeria?

Yes, you can license your intellectual property rights to others in Nigeria through a legally binding agreement that specifies the terms of use, duration, and compensation for the licensed property.

9. What are the benefits of enforcing my intellectual property rights in Nigeria?

Enforcing your intellectual property rights in Nigeria can protect your creations from unauthorized use, generate revenue through licensing agreements, and enhance the value of your intellectual property assets.

10. How can a lawyer help me with my intellectual property matters in Nigeria?

A lawyer experienced in intellectual property law in Nigeria can assist you with the registration, protection, enforcement, and licensing of your intellectual property rights, as well as represent you in disputes and litigation involving intellectual property.
